After selling your car, you should transfer the title to the new owner, cancel your insurance policy, and notify the DMV of the sale. Additionally, you may want to consider how you will get around without a car and if you need to purchase a new one.

Is a car dealer required to inspect a car before selling it?

Yes, a car dealer needs to have the cars inspected before selling them. However, a person who is just selling their car, does not have to get it inspected. The buyer should always have someone else look over the car to be sure.

What are some tips for selling your car?

A car offered for sale should be clean inside and out. It should be washed and polished. The service history should be available and shown to a buyer to show that the car has been regularly serviced.
